Here's a great way to end your week. Straight from PAX East in Boston comes this 6-minute video showing off Diablo III for PlayStation 4 running in 1080p at 60fps. The video features commentary from Blizzard senior producer Julia Humphreys and senior level designer Matthew Berger.

The PS4 version of Diablo III, titled the Ultimate Evil Edition, was announced during BlizzCon 2013 in November. It includes the main game and its Reaper of Souls expansion.

The video also touches on some of the game's new features, like its Mail, Player Gifts, and Nemesis systems, as well as the Apprentice Mode. We also learn in the video that Diablo III for PS4 will include all of the PC patches, which means the game will be "very finely tuned," Berger said.

Blizzard has not announced a release date for Diablo III: Ultimate Evil Edition for PS4. An Xbox One version is currently in development, but Blizzard is not sure if it will ever be released. Already reached level 70 in Diablo III? Check out GameSpot's guide to understanding its endgame content.
